WebA ganglion cyst is a lump, typically round or oval, that can develop on the hand or wrist. It may be as small as a pea or it can grow up to about an inch in diameter. Generally speaking, ganglion cysts are nothing to worry about. Fairly common, they are usually harmless, aren’t cancerous, don’t spread, and often disappear on their own. WebCystic ganglionosis is the presence of multiple ganglion cysts involving multiple joints. The reason and pathogenesis behind the development of multiple ganglion cysts is unclear as this is extremely rare. Further studies need to be performed regarding the pathogenesis and genetic predisposition, if any, behind the multiplicity.
